A big fire is raging in #Kherson amid rumours it could be yet another strike on Russian gear at the airport #Chornobaivka (#Chernobaevka)

Governor of neighouring Mykolaiv, Vitaly Kim began the rumours by posting a photo of the blaze and then "1 April, Chernobaevka"
